Key Factors That Influence Betting Outcomes

There are many variables that come into play when you’re deciding where and how to place your bets. For example, in football, team form, injury reports, and coaching strategies can dramatically shift the odds. Similarly, in basketball, player matchups and pace of play are vital considerations. Understanding these elements is often what separates casual bettors from those who consistently perform better.

The rise of analytics tools and live data feeds has made it easier to access real-time information. In fact, providers like Bet365 and FanDuel rely heavily on sophisticated algorithms to adjust odds dynamically throughout a game. Yet, even with data at your fingertips, emotional bias and overconfidence remain pitfalls many bettors face.

Practical Tips for Navigating the Betting Maze

Getting started with sports wagering can feel overwhelming, but certain practical habits can make a difference. Here are some essentials that I’ve found valuable over the years:

  1. Set a budget: Decide in advance how much you’re willing to risk and stick to it. This discipline prevents chasing losses, a common mistake.
  2. Research before betting: Spend time studying recent trends, head-to-head stats, and any relevant news.
  3. Shop for the best odds: Different bookmakers offer varying odds, so comparing multiple sources can improve your potential returns.
  4. Keep emotions in check: Avoid betting on your favorite team out of loyalty rather than rational analysis.
  5. Track your bets: Maintain a record to analyze your performance and identify patterns.

With these guidelines, even those new to sports wagering can approach it with a degree of confidence and restraint.

Technology’s Role in Modern Sports Betting

Technology has reshaped the entire sports betting experience. Mobile apps now allow bets to be placed instantly, while live betting options enable wagering as the action unfolds. Payment methods have also diversified; popular options like Apple Pay, PayPal, and cryptocurrencies provide added convenience and security. Many platforms operate under strict regulatory frameworks, including licensing auth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ission and Malta Gaming Authority, ensuring fairness and transparency.

Yet, it’s essential to remain vigilant. Even with advanced software and SSL encryption, the human element—decision making—remains unpredictable. What to Keep in Mind About Responsible Betting

Betting, by its nature, involves risk. It can be enjoyable and rewarding but also carries the potential for financial harm when not approached carefully. Most experienced bettors I know emphasize responsibility: know your limits, avoid betting under stress or fatigue, and never view betting as a way to solve financial problems.

Setting clear boundaries protects not just your wallet but your peace of mind. If at any point the thrill turns into compulsion, seeking help or stepping back is the smartest bet you can make.
